High-level Qatar–Norway call focuses on regional security

The Prime Minister and Minister of Foreign Affairs, Sheikh Mohammed bin Abdulrahman bin Jassim Al Thani, held a telephone conversation with the Prime Minister of the Kingdom of Norway, Jonas Gahr Støre, to discuss the latest developments surrounding the military escalation in the region and its wider implications for regional and international peace and security.

Both sides reviewed ongoing diplomatic efforts aimed at resolving disputes through peaceful dialogue, underscoring the urgent need to prevent further escalation of tensions.

During the call, the Qatari Prime Minister called for an immediate halt to what he described as unjustified attacks by Iran against Qatar and other countries in the region. He also warned against any targeting of critical infrastructure, particularly facilities connected to water security, food supply chains, and energy production.

He further stressed the importance of enhancing coordination, strengthening joint diplomatic initiatives, and returning to negotiations to contain the crisis. He reiterated that a diplomatic solution remains essential to ensuring global energy security, safeguarding freedom of navigation, protecting the environment, and maintaining regional stability.
